Gorey Unveiled: Where Coastal Charm Meets Timeless Tradition
Discover the charm of Gorey, County Wexford, an enchanting Irish town that perfectly blends history and modern allure. Stroll down its vibrant streets lined with boutique shops and cozy cafes, or explore the ruins of the medieval Gorey Castle. Nearby, the stunning beaches of Curracloe and Ballymoney invite you for sun-soaked days and scenic walks along the coast. Don't miss the annual Gorey Arts Festival, celebrating local talent and creativity. With its welcoming atmosphere and rich cultural experiences, Gorey is a delightful getaway for travelers seeking a taste of authentic Ireland. Best time to go to Gorey
Gorey experiences its lowest average temperature in January, at 43.3°F (6.3°C), while July is the hottest month, with an average temperature of 59.0°F (15.0°C). October is usually the wettest month. July to September are the peak travel months in Gorey, attracting a higher number of tourists. During this peak period, the weather is mostly sunny to mostly cloudy, accompanied by light rainfall. On the other hand, January, November, and December tend to be quieter times to visit, marked by light rainfall and mostly cloudy conditions.
